I currently have several RCA RCU810 remotes. I have been using them along with my old parallel JP1 cable for at least 10 years. It's time for a change since some of the buttons aren't working anymore. I have taken them apart and cleaned them and put contact ink on the buttons, etc. They just are on their last leg.
All I want in a remote is an inexpensive, JP1 remote for 4 devices that is backlit. My dream feature would be to have the backlight light up whenever I picked up or moved the remote? Is there such a thing?

The cheapest JP1 backlit remote is the Atlas 1056B01/B03 series used by a number of cable companies, and generally available for $15 or so on the net. (EBay).  Those are 5 device remotes (the B03 is internally 8 devices, but we haven't fully wrung out interacting via JP1 yet.  There are some others, and you would probalby get more responses at [Link: hifi-remote.com].   I don't know of any JP1 remtoes that turn on the back light from motion. 

The JP1 tools (RMIR) is very easy to use, and works under Windows, MAc,and Linux.
